What Does ‘I Can Be Reached on My Cell’ Mean?

The phrase “I can be reached on my cell” simply means that you are available and can be contacted via your mobile phone. It’s a polite and direct way to let someone know how they can get in touch with you.

Meaning & Definition

  • Meaning: You are available to receive calls or messages on your mobile phone.
  • Definition: It indicates that you are accessible, and someone can reach out to you by calling or texting your cell phone.

This expression is incredibly useful, whether you’re giving your contact information to a friend or telling a colleague how to get in touch with you. It implies that your cell phone is the best way to reach you, especially when you’re on the go.

Grammar Tips for Saying ‘I Can Be Reached on My Cell’

Understanding the grammatical structure of the phrase “I can be reached on my cell” can help ensure that you use it correctly in your communication. Let’s break it down.

Understanding the Structure: Modal Verb + Passive Voice

The phrase “I can be reached on my cell” follows a simple grammatical structure involving a modal verb and the passive voice:

  1. Modal Verb: “Can” is used to express ability or possibility.
  2. Passive Voice: “Be reached” is a passive construction, where the subject (you) is the receiver of the action (being contacted).

This structure implies that you are available to receive communication but doesn’t specify who will be contacting you. It’s more focused on your availability rather than the action itself.

Related Post  Exciting Opportunity: How to Seize the Moment for Career and Personal Growth

When to Use “Can” vs. “May” for Expressing Availability

While “can” is the most common modal verb used in this type of construction, “may” is sometimes used, though it has a slightly different tone:

  • “Can” is more casual and expresses ability. It’s used in most everyday conversations and informal contexts.
    Example:
    “You can reach me on my cell anytime.”
  • “May” is a bit more formal and expresses permission or politeness. It’s often used in formal written communication.
    Example:
    “You may reach me on my cell after 6 PM.”

So, while “can” works in most cases, feel free to switch to “may” if you want to add a formal tone to your message.

Common Mistakes to Avoid

While the phrase “I can be reached on my cell” is simple, there are still a few common mistakes that can confuse the message. Let’s look at some of these.

Mistake 1: Incorrect Phrasing: “I can reached on my cell”

  • Why It’s Wrong:
    The phrase “I can reached on my cell” is grammatically incorrect because it’s missing the auxiliary verb “be,” which is necessary for the passive voice.
  • Corrected Version:
    “I can be reached on my cell.”

Mistake 2: Confusing Availability with Other Phrases like “I’ll Call You Back”

  • Why It’s Wrong:
    “I’ll call you back” and “I can be reached on my cell” may sound similar, but they have different meanings. “I’ll call you back” indicates that you will initiate the communication, while “I can be reached on my cell” indicates that others can contact you.
  • Corrected Version:
    If you’re letting someone know you’re available, stick with “I can be reached on my cell” or a variation of it.
    If you’re promising to call back, use “I’ll call you back.”

Mistake 3: Overuse of Formality in Informal Settings

  • Why It’s Wrong:
    In casual conversations, saying “I can be reached on my cell” can sound overly formal, especially with friends or family. It’s important to adjust your tone based on the setting.
  • Corrected Version:
    In informal settings, you might say, “Just call me on my cell” or “I’m on my cell if you need me.”
